Solve for c
a (b - c) = d.

Respuesta :

abdullahtalha877 abdullahtalha877
  • 11-10-2021

Answer: C = b-(d/a)

Step-by-step explanation:

Given, a(b-c) = d

or, b-c = d/a

or, -c =(d/a)-b

or, c = b-(d/a)
